Ten Reasons to Watch the Short Film ~ Anaganaga Oka Nanna



US-based talented Writer and Director, Deepti Ganta's entrance into the world of film-making has started with a bang. Her short film, Anaganaga Oka Nanna is making strides with trending in the Top 10 list soon after it's release on YouTube on Father's day.  In this world of instant fame with social media and a continuous stream of entertainment that comes our way, it is important to acknowledge certain works of art that create impact. Looking forward to the next full-length movie by Ms. Ganta.  


So here are my top ten reasons on why you should watch this movie: 


(1) Originality ~ Beautifully written by Ms. Ganta, an original theme dedicated to fathers who are willing to stand up to societal norms and treat their sons and daughters equally.


(2) Strong Message ~ The message portrays the monumental difference that could be created with a change in perception. The movie is geared towards changing mindsets and the willingness to erase gender stereotypes.  


(3) Ace Performances ~ Each character is real and you can relate to the subtle emotions they experience.


(4) Peripheral messages ~  While the central theme is based on stereotypes, there are also peripheral messages that are beautifully conveyed relating to dowry and other social issues. (I am trying not to give it all away)


(5) Respectful ~ An important lesson in today's world is to disagree respectfully. While the protagonists disagree with the archaic style of thinking, the characters express that very tactfully, without being negative or critical.


(6) Crisp Transitions and Editing~  The story moves through  flashbacks and possibilities. The perfect editing makes the transitions so smooth that you can easily follow the story.


(7)  Cinematography and music~ The professional quality of the movie cannot be denied. In today's world where movies are created by the dozen, the quality is very evident. The background music is soothing as well. 


(8) Short and Sweet ~ All of 12 minutes, this movie does not have a single dull moment. Since time is of essence and one needs to pick what to watch.. you should certainly pick this movie as it can entertain and impact you at lightning speed.



(9) Beautiful Poetry rendition ~ The movie concludes with a beautiful poem by Siri Yarlagadda that is simple, yet conveys a resounding message of letting children be what they are...


(10) Motivational: And my top reason for hailing this film...  it is motivational, even if your own background is not the same and you do not relate to the theme.
